Biblical counseling holds two truths together at once: your marriage needs compassion, and it needs structure.
Scripture gives your covenant a foundation stronger than emotion, pride, fear, or the culture around you.
Practical counseling hands you the tools to communicate, repair trust, set boundaries, and make decisions with wisdom.
One without the other leaves you halfway.
Together, they open a path forward.
I start by listening, because people don’t care what you know until they know you care.
My first job is to understand the specific circumstance that knocked your marriage sideways: what I call the gut punch.
It’s the argument that keeps repeating, the silence that’s grown between you, the moment your words went in one ear and out the other.
Once we name it together, I bring biblical truth to bear on that exact situation.
What you receive isn’t a general sermon. It’s a specific word for your specific marriage.
From there, we build practical steps you can both apply at home.
And I teach you to do that reflection on your own, so the work keeps going long after our sessions end.
Reveal: Identify the Pattern. Together we name what keeps repeating between you, the argument, the distance, the fear, or the unmet need beneath the surface.
Realign: Return to God’s Design. We sort worldly thinking from biblical truth and rebuild your marriage around covenant, humility, forgiveness, and shared purpose.
Respond: Practice New Guardrails. I help you create practical agreements for communication, finances, family boundaries, conflict repair, and intimacy, so your marriage can move in a healthier direction.
